| Nutrient (per 100 g) | Hot dog sandwich, reduced fat, on white bun | PIZZA HUT 12" Super Supreme Pizza, Hand-Tossed Crust |
|---|---|---|
| Calories | 244 kcal | 243 kcal |
| Protein | 12 g | 10.9 g |
| Carbohydrates | 25 g | 25.6 g |
| Fat | 10.5 g | 10.7 g |
| Fibre | 0.8 g | 2 g |
| Sugar | 3.2 g | 3.7 g |
| Sodium | 561 mg | 689 mg |
All values per 100 g. Source: USDA FoodData Central.

Hot dog sandwich, reduced fat, on white bun provides 244 kcal per 100 g, with 12 g of protein, 25 g of carbohydrates and 10.5 g of fat. 1 sandwich of Hot dog sandwich, reduced fat, on white bun (102 g) provides about 249 kcal.

The hot dog sandwich, reduced fat, on a white bun is a popular convenience food that has its roots in the classic American barbecue and street food culture. Originally derived from German sausages, this dish has evolved into a beloved quick meal option, often found at sporting events, picnics, and casual dining establishments. The reduced-fat version maintains the essential flavors while providing a healthier alternative, making it suitable for those looking to manage their fat intake without sacrificing taste. This sandwich typically contains 244 calories per 100 grams, comprising 12 grams of protein, 25 grams of carbohydrates, and 10.5 grams of fat.
